Duality between N=5 and N=6 Chern-Simons matter theory
Abstract
We provide evidences for the duality between N=6 U(M)4 × U(N)-4 Chern-Simons matter theory and N=5 O(M)2 × USp(2N)-1 theory for a suitable M,N by working out the superconformal index, which shows perfect matching. For N=5 theories, we show that supersymmetry is enhanced to N=6 by explicitly constructing monopole operators filling in SO(6)R R-currents. Finally we work out the large N index of O(2N)2k × USp(2N)-k and show that it exactly matches with the gravity index on AdS4 × S7/Dk, which further provides additional evidence for the duality between the N=5 and N=6 theory for k=1
